Espinito
Espinito is a village in Municipio Lobatera, Táchira. Espinito is situated nearby to the village La Cuchilla, as well as near Santa Filomena.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Palmira and Lobatera.
Palmira
Town
Palmira is a town in Táchira, Venezuela. It is the capital of Guásimos Municipality. It was founded in 1627 by Fernando Saavedra and in 1642 by Captain Luis Sosa Lovera. In 2011, it had a population of 43.236. Palmira is situated 6 km south of Espinito.
Lobatera
Town
Lobatera is a town in Táchira State, Venezuela. It is the capital of Lobatera Municipality and is located in the Lobatera valley in the Andean region of Táchira, on a small plateau at the confluence of the Lobatera and La Molina streams, at 968 m above sea level. Lobatera is situated 6 km northwest of Espinito.
Táriba
Town

Táriba is a town in Táchira, Venezuela, and is the capital of the Cárdenas Municipality. It was founded in 1602. Táriba has a population of 128,590. It's located on the outsides of the city of San Cristóbal. Táriba is situated 8 km south of Espinito.
